As of July 2025 Pilbara Minerals has a market cap of C$4.49 Billion. This makes Pilbara Minerals the world's 3674th most valuable company by market cap according to our data. The market capitalization, commonly called market cap, is the total market value of a publicly traded company's outstanding shares and is commonly used to measure how much a company is worth.
